SQL Server Management Studio入门教程:数据库创建与管理详解
5星 · 超过95%的资源 需积分: 5 144 浏览量
更新于2024-07-01
2
收藏 335KB PDF 举报
本文档是关于数据库管理系统SQL Server Management Studio (SSMS)的学习笔记,专为初学者设计,涵盖了从创建数据库到使用SQL语句进行数据操作的全面教程。首先,理解数据库的基本概念,它是一个按照数据结构组织和管理数据的仓库,而数据库管理系统则是用于管理和控制数据库的软件系统,包括数据库、数据库管理系统以及数据库系统三者的关系。
创建数据库是学习的基础,通过SSMS工具或脚本实现,例如在本地或远程服务器上设置服务器名称(如local.127.0.0.1或远程IP),并选择身份验证方式(Windows身份验证或SQL Server身份验证),配置登录名和密码。在Windows身份验证中,还需创建新的登录名并分配相应的服务器角色以赋予权限。
数据库的主要组成部分包括数据文件(.mdf)、次要数据文件(.ndf,可选)和事务日志文件(.ldf,每个数据库至少需要一个)。文件组作为一种逻辑管理单元,将这些文件组织起来,分为主文件组(存放主要数据和未指定文件组的文件)和用户自定义文件组。
设计数据库时,应遵循一些原则,如文件归属单一文件组、避免多数据库共享文件、数据和日志文件分开,以及日志文件不能作为文件组的一部分。接下来,介绍了数据库中的关键对象:
1. 表:是数据存储的核心,由行和列组成,用于组织和存储具体的数据,每个字段具有特定的数据类型。
2. 字段:表中的列,决定数据的存储类型,如整型、字符型等。
3. 视图:虚拟表,由多个表的查询结果构成,提供用户以特定视角查看数据的便捷方式。
4. 索引:提高数据查询效率的工具,基于表创建,允许快速定位数据,减少了全表扫描的需要。
5. 存储过程:预编译的SQL语句集合,执行特定任务,如查询、插入、更新和删除数据,提升了代码复用性和性能。
通过学习和实践这些内容,初学者可以更好地理解和操作SQL Server Management Studio,进而掌握数据库管理的基础知识。
2019-06-21 上传
2011-10-25 上传
2009-08-19 上传
2011-12-07 上传
132 浏览量
2022-11-28 上传
2008-11-06 上传
yuansec
- 粉丝: 81
- 资源: 3
最新资源
- 非常不错的在线邮件群发系统官方版v1.1
- ng-auth:角度中的简单身份验证受限状态
- 4Coders-MeuCandidatoIdeal:黑客马拉松透明度巴西应用程序
- Memory-Game:原生Android记忆游戏应用
- 心情MTV网站系统官方版 v2.0
- 红警2mix文件加密器
- chasqientrega:https
- 广告牌彩灯闪烁控制程序+设计说明.rar
- frontend-boilerplate
- aspectjs:aspectjs切面编程
- mail-bot:基于条件的邮件机器人
- Hotel_website:CSS中的基本酒店网站
- 手机九宫格html5网站模板
- 水国类数据集(CV专用)
- 中国城市区域数据.zip
- ASOFI3D_时域各向异性地震建模_c语言_地震建模_时域_各向异性_ASOFI3D_建模_地震_3D